Discover how your dog's behavior reveals their unmet needs. The discussion dives into five core areas: emotional, physical, social, mental, and daily thrive. Misbehavior could be a cry for help! Learn about common struggles dog owners face and how they relate to these needs. Explore the significance of psychological safety alongside physical well-being. Nutrition, sleep, and exercise also play key roles in your dog's happiness. Shift from frustration to understanding and create a deeper bond for a well-behaved dog.

ANECDOTE

Regret Over Past Training Methods

  • Susan Garrett once used collar corrections to stop puppy nipping, a method she no longer supports.
  • She reflects this caused a lack of psychological safety and regrets those early training approaches.
INSIGHT

Behavior Reflects Emotional Needs

  • Susan Garrett identifies emotional challenges as the biggest dog training challenges.
  • Behavior issues often stem from unmet emotional needs that dogs communicate to us.
ADVICE

Ensure Psychological Safety

  • Provide psychological safety by avoiding judgment, blame, or harsh punishment.
  • Encourage your dog's curiosity and allow freedom to express their true self safely.
